The news of her departure was a real blow to fans. The actress died in London, and her death left a deep void in the hearts of the audience. Many admitted that they grew up watching her films, and the artist’s contribution to world cinema cannot be overestimated.

Few people knew that in her youth she doubted her appearance and considered herself unsuitable for the screen. However, her love of theater turned out to be stronger than her fears: she began acting on stage in Oxford, and after graduation joined the troupe of the legendary London Old Vic Theater.

The real breakthrough happened in Harry Potter, where the role of the professor took her career to a new level. At the same time, a personal drama unfolded behind the scenes: during filming, the actress was diagnosed with cancer, but despite the illness, she continued to work, demonstrating incredible fortitude and dedication to the profession.
